Plate Nut Spacer

NSN: 5310-00-980-2411 | Model: NAS1195D4XM

An item having two flat bearing surfaces, conforming to the same shape as the base of a nut (1), plain, plate and nut (1), self-locking, plate. It is used to provide better alignment in assembly.
